Ilustrado
Ilustrado, one of the well-known Intramuros restaurants, is next on the list. Upon entering its gates, you will be instantly transported to the grand Manila of the past, exuding Filipino-Spanish beauty and elegance. Experience the enlightenment of Ilustrado’s signature dishes, which are heavily influenced by Spanish flavors such as callos madrilena and seafood paella. These delectable creations, bursting with savory goodness, can only be found at Ilustrado. Don’t miss out on the chance to sample their seasonal degustation menu, allowing you to fully immerse yourself in their entire culinary repertoire.
Their original specialty dessert, Sampaguita ice cream, is something you definitely shouldn’t miss. It’s a delightful combination of vanilla ice cream and the essence of the Philippines’ national flower. Don’t hesitate to give it a try; you won’t be let down.
Barbara Heritage:
Barbara’s Heritage Restaurant is another notable Filipino eatery in Manila, located within the historic walls of Intramuros. Step inside Barbara’s and be transported to a bygone era with its charming ambiance and decor inspired by the Spanish era.
Before you indulge your taste buds, make sure to feast your eyes on the delightful surroundings. Barbara’s, a popular spot for weddings, baptisms, and other gatherings, is a must-see destination when visiting Intramuros.
Barbara’s Heritage buffet offers a thoughtfully selected assortment of traditional Filipino dishes, including the timeless adobo, kare-kare (a flavorful combination of beef and pork in a rich peanut sauce), and Barbara’s famous gambas (a delicious shrimp dish perfect as an appetizer or main course).
Cafe Adriatico:
Caf Adriatico, a cherished establishment at the Remedios Circle in Manila for more than four decades, is a must-mention when discussing the top Filipino restaurants in Manila. With its expansion into various cities, Caf Adriatico continues to be the symbol that potentially initiated the café culture in the city.
Interestingly, it was not coffee that made Caf Adriatico famous in history, but rather its thick and velvety tsokolate eh, a decadent chocolate drink made from locally sourced cacao beans. This delicious beverage is prepared using traditional methods and served in a distinctive Rizal demitasse. It serves as the perfect ending to a delightful selection of comfort food, including pasta dishes, classic and modern dishes, and the beloved beef salpicao. All of these culinary delights are either created or influenced by the restaurant’s founder, Larry J. Cruz. Caf Adriatico is one of the renowned Filipino restaurants owned by LJC Restaurants in the Philippines.

Romula Cafe:
Carlos P. Romulo, a well-known Filipino journalist and diplomat who received the Pulitzer Prize for Peace in 1941, is the inspiration behind Romulo Café. This cherished eatery has several locations throughout the city, allowing you to savor the authentic flavors of traditional Filipino cuisine that have been handed down through generations.
Caf Romulo has gained fame for its meticulous attention to technique and precision in creating both traditional and inventive dishes. It comes as no surprise that their chicken relleno, beef kaldereta, and chicken inasal sisig have remained popular over time. The restaurant’s ability to present and enhance familiar Filipino cuisine while preserving its comforting essence is what sets Caf Romulo apart.
Kanin Club:
Anticipate the finest Filipino delicacies such as crispy pork binagoongan, adobo, crispy dinuguan, kaldereta, and more! In Filipino, “Kanin” translates to rice, and this establishment provides a range of flavored rice perfect for sharing or indulging in by yourself. Additionally, you have the option to order unlimited rice to accompany the array of delectable Filipino accompaniments.

If you’re craving the flavors of the northern Philippines but don’t want to endure long hours of travel, Victorino’s Restaurant in Quezon City is the perfect place for you. Run by DV Savellano and Queenie Paras, siblings from Ilocos Sur, this cozy Filipino-Ilocano eatery brings the best of Ilocano cuisine right to your table. Indulge in their delicious dishes like poqui-poqui, a delightful combination of eggplant, onions, and tomatoes, or savor their lomo-lomo, a delectable beef broth with a light touch of egg.
